If information is capital, and knowledge is power, then what does that make data? For the people who devote their lives to parsing it, it is nothing less than the raw material that creates understanding – making it the most valuable resource imaginable. And yet for so much of the world, data remains an obscure and remote thing: the currency of corporations and scientists; not everyday people. Duncan Clark has made it his mission to change that. As a data journalist at The Guardian, it was Duncan Clark’s job to divine the stories hidden inside massive sets of data, and present them to the world in a manner that could be understood. The fundamental difficulty of that simple intention is what led him to create his first company, Flourish – a visual storytelling platform that made data presentable and understandable. That work caught the attention of the disruptive design suite Canva, who acquired Flourish in 2022, and have since named Duncan Clark their Head of Europe. Canva already reaches nearly 200 million users a month – and has achieved a valuation of 2.5 billion dollars. But for Duncan Clark, this is about more than the growth of a company; it’s about democratising the raw power of data, and ensuring that everyone the world over has all of the “ingredients of understanding” at their fingertips. In this inspiring conversation, we see how Duncan Clark kept that mission at the forefront of his mind, as he made his incredible leap from journalism to entrepreneurship and beyond.
